			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class="KonaBody"><p>Property owners facing expensive energy bills are looking for methods to make their houses more comfortable an energy efficient. A number of small actions will all add up, and not only make a significant difference in your power bill, but can increase the value of your property over time.&nbsp;</p>
<p> In most houses, the biggest energy consumers are the major appliances such as refrigerators, washing machines, dishwashers and all the electronics that entertain us and make our lives easier. Recent models of all major appliances have gone through review under the U.S. EPA EnergyStar rating scheme that determines the actual rate of savings gained when new appliances are brought in. Aside from the fact that they use less power, newer appliances make less noise, perform better and do not face imminent repair bills since the warranty still stands. Another way to make a difference in your monthly power costs is to replace small appliances like crock pots, toaster ovens and microwaves with energy efficient models.</p>
<p> Old homes, and sometimes newer constructions, often do not have proper insulation up in the roof which makes your heating and cooling system to lose efficiency. By installing modern insulation on the floor and roof lines of the attic, a lot of heat may be harnessed rather than dissipating when you need it most. By installing an attic fan, you can force the hot air out so that on comfortable days you will not need to run the air conditioner. <p>Solar power arrays, windmills and geothermal HVAC systems can be installed to virtually take your home off the grid and they often pay for the investment in twenty years, and afterwards you&#8217;ll be receiving free renewable energy. For smaller equipments, solar panels can be used on outdoor appliances to power your outdoor lights, gate opener, swimming pool filtration system and hot tub water heater. <p>Especially in very dry areas, water costs may be a substantial expense, and having proper measures in place to conserve water is always a smart idea. Installing low-flow faucets, toilets and drip irrigation systems can decrease your daily intake of water.</p>
<p> Another great tool to heat and cool your house is the proper choice of the plants you use in the yard, particularly close to your home. Large leafy trees, shrubs and well-placed trellises will help filter sunlight and keep windows and walls that receive lots of light cooler. An additional energy-saving idea is to plant evergreens in a row to divert winter winds.</p>

<p>The money will soon be in the pipeline.  Huge amounts, to the tune of around $825 Billion dollars ($550 Billion in new spending and $275 Billion in tax cuts).  This time, however,  the money will not go to bankers and wall street firms, but to businesses as well as state and local governments all around the country.  It is hoped not just by the Obama administration that this will halt the slide in the downward spiraling economy, but by just about every American as well.  This massive amount of stimulus will hopefully not only halt the increasing number of unemployed, but will turn the tide and start building the ranks of those with jobs and new careers that will help to position our country for the challenges that we will continue to face as this new century matures.  For those that are ready for a change in their career in the next year or two, understanding where the money is going to flow during that time and for years to follow could allow themselves to ride that wave of money into a rewarding and potentially lucrative career.</p>
<p>This &#8220;American Recovery and Reinvestment Plan&#8221; is continueing to change as this article is written, as is anything subject to political negotiations, but the basic outline of where the majority of these funds will be directed is pretty well known at this point.   The money will basically be spent with 90 % of it going to the private sector, while the other 10% will be directed towards the public sector.  The money is alloted in general to four broad catagories&#8230; infrastructure, energy, education, and health.</p>
<p>Some of the funds will have an immediate effect, and some of the spending will not be in full swing until 2010 and 2011.  In researching what type of career you may be interested in, understanding when the flow of money will hit into the areas of your interst is important to make a wise career choice.  Getting the appropriate education and training for many of these positions will need to be meshed with the timeline of those money flows in order to best benefit.</p>
